How they compare
Mongolia currently reports 36.0% against 33.0% in Congo, a difference of 3.0%.
That makes Mongolia's figure about 1.1 times Congo's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Mongolia ahead.
Congo ranks 133rd and Mongolia ranks 130th of 141 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Congo averaged higher in 1 and Mongolia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Congo | Mongolia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 3.1% | 1.2% | 1.9% | Congo |
| 2010s | 21.0% | 24.1% | 3.1% | Mongolia |
| 2020s | 28.2% | 38.8% | 10.6% | Mongolia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
